Dr. Aamir Jafarey has been associated with the Centre of Biomedical Ethics and Culture, SIUT since its inception in October 2004. He trained in bioethics as a Fogarty Fellow in the Department of Population and International Health, Harvard School of Public Health, and obtained a Masters in bioethics from the Sindh Institute of Medical Sciences. Dr. Jafarey has been involved in bioethics related activities in Pakistan since 1997 and has been the recipient of several grants for bioethics related projects. He has conducted several research projects and has published in national and international journals. He serves as a reviewer for several bioethics journals and is member of the international advisory board of the Indian journal of Medical Ethics. He has been invited to present papers at symposia and conferences and has conducted numerous workshops at various institutions nationally and across the region. Dr. Jafarey has served in different Ethical Review Committees and is currently serving as the Coordinator of the Ethics Review Committee of SIUT. At CBEC, Dr. Jafarey is involved in managing, organizing and teaching during the Postgraduate Diploma in Bioethics, and Master of Bioethics courses, in addition to organizing various other bioethics related events offered through the Centre.
